What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Online School Psychologist,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Online School Psychologist, you need a graduate degree in school psychology, state licensure or certification, and expertise in psychological assessment and intervention for students. Familiarity with teletherapy platforms, digital assessment tools, and secure information systems is crucial for remote service delivery. Outstanding communication, empathy, and problem-solving skills help build trust with students, families, and school staff in a virtual environment. These competencies ensure that students receive effective, ethical, and accessible psychological support, even when delivered online.

How do Online School Psychologists typically collaborate with teachers and parents to support student success?

Online School Psychologists work closely with teachers and parents through virtual meetings, emails, and digital platforms to share insights, develop intervention strategies, and monitor student progress. They often lead or participate in multidisciplinary teams to design individualized education plans and support positive behavioral interventions. Regular communication and collaborative problem-solving are key, as these professionals help ensure that students' academic, social, and emotional needs are addressed, even in a remote setting.

What does an online school psychologist do?

An online school psychologist provides psychological services to students, families, and school staff through virtual platforms. Their responsibilities include conducting assessments, offering counseling, developing intervention strategies, and collaborating with educators to support student learning and well-being. They also help address behavioral, emotional, and academic concerns and ensure students have access to appropriate resources, all while maintaining confidentiality and adhering to ethical guidelines.

JOB DESCRIPTION:
The School Psychologist is responsible for providing the psychological services related to the management and learning of students with special needs.
The School Social Worker is responsible for the provision of student and family counseling and social services.
TYPICAL DUTIES (School Psychologist):
  1. Provide individual psychological evaluation services as required.
  2. Provide student and family counseling as mandated by the Regulations of the Commissioner or stipulated in Individual Educational Plans.
  3. Assist in developing procedures for maintaining classroom management related to learning and/or behavioral problems.
  4. Assist in communicating directly with teachers and parents the results of psychological evaluations and observations of students, as well as recommendations for procedures to alleviate difficult learning and/or behavioral problems.
  5. Communicate with agencies working with students and families.
  6. Prepare and maintain up-dated psychological records, including activities such as evaluations, observation of students, and communications with community agencies.
  7. Participate in staffing conferences to review the programs and progress of students.
  8. Serve as instructor in workshop programs offered for Special Education staff, participating school district staffs and parents.
  9. Perform such other professional duties as may be assigned by the Supervisor of Special Education.

TYPICAL DUTIES (School Social Worker):
  1. Counsel students and family members for interpersonal and/or behavior problems associated with school.
  2. Inform teachers about pertinent experiences that influence student behavior.
  3. Establish and maintain liaison with agencies working with the students and their families, such as Social Security for SSI benefits, Family Court for matters relating to wills and guardianship, the juvenile court system and the Division of Youth.
  4. Participate in staffing conferences to review the programs and progress of students.
  5. Prepare and maintain up-dated records including activities such as triennial social histories, parent conference summaries, and communications with community agencies.
  6. Perform such other professionally related duties as may be assigned by the Special Education Supervisor.

QUALIFICATIONS:
NYS Certification as a School Psychologist or School Social Worker required. NYS License as a LMSW or LCSW if NYS SSW certified. Experience strongly preferred.
